Pennsylvania High School Basketball - Bishop Carroll falls to Greater Johnstown
February 12, 2011: Ebensburg, PA 15931 The Greater Johnstown Trojans basketball team scored 80 points and held the host Bishop Carroll Huskies to 62 in the Trojans non-league triumph on Saturday.
The Trojans now sport a 17-1 record. They put it on the line next when they travel to Somerset for a Laurel Highlands 2 contest on Tuesday, February 15. Greater Johnstown will confront a Golden Eagles team coming off a 96-67 non-league loss to Forest Hills (Sidman, PA). The Golden Eagles record now stands at 7-14.
The Huskies (10-9) will now prepare for their contest against Bishop Guilfoyle (Altoona, PA). The Marauders enter the Laurel Highlands 1 contest with a 9-12 record. In their last contest, Bishop Guilfoyle was defeated by Bishop McCort (Johnstown, PA), 67-45, in a non-league contest.
